Yes, You Can Share Games!
Good news, Nintendo fans! You absolutely can share games on the Nintendo Switch. Nintendo allows you to do so through a feature called ‘Game Sharing’ or ‘Primary and Non-Primary Console’ setup. It’s pretty cool!
By setting up one Nintendo Switch as your ‘Primary Console’ and another as a ‘Non-Primary Console’, you can share digital game downloads across both devices. This means, as long as you’re not playing the same game at the same time, you can enjoy your digital library with a friend or family member. Keep in mind, internet access is required to play shared games on the Non-Primary console.
